WebThe Food and Drug Administration has not approved the use of me-tronidazole in animals. Federal law prohibits the extra-label use of nitroimidazoles in food-producing animals.{R-27} Canada— Metronidazole is not approved for use in food-producing animals. There are no established withdrawal times. Chemistry Chemical group: Nitroimidazoles.
